Explain the circular nature of the relationship between personality maladjustment and reading failure.?

Personality maladjustment, such as low self-esteem or anxiety, can contribute to reading failure by affecting a child's motivation, attention, and overall emotional well-being, which can impact their ability to learn. Conversely, experiencing reading failure can also lead to feelings of frustration, embarrassment, and academic challenges, which in turn can contribute to the development of personality maladjustment issues. This circular relationship highlights the interconnectedness between academic struggles and emotional well-being in children.

Why are clocks circle?

Unfortunately, not all clocks are circular. The reason that most clocks are circular is because of convenience. As clocks rely on the rotation of the hands to tell time, it is simply easier for the numbers to be arranged in a circular formation around it.
